Artur Lyavitski (Belarusian: Артур Лявіцкі; Russian: Артур Левицкий; born 17 March 1985) is a Belarusian professional footballer who plays for Torpedo Mogilev.
Honours
Gomel
- Belarusian Cup winner: 2010–11
- Belarusian Super Cup winner: 2012
Minsk
- Belarusian Cup winner: 2012–13
